php css怎么控制内容是否显示图片

worktile 其他 77

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PHP中,可以使用if语句和CSS来控制内容是否显示图片。下面是具体的方法:

    1. 通过PHP判断是否显示图片:
    在PHP中,可以使用if语句根据条件来判断是否显示图片。首先,要获取一个条件,例如判断某个变量是否为真或假。然后,可以使用if语句来执行相应的操作。示例代码如下:

    “`php
    ‘;
    }
    else {
    echo ‘不显示图片’;
    }
    ?>
    “`

    在上面的示例代码中,首先设置了一个变量`$showImage`,并赋值为`true`。然后使用if语句来判断该变量的值,如果为`true`,则显示图片;如果为`false`,则显示文本”不显示图片”。

    2. 通过PHP控制CSS样式来控制图片的显示:
    还可以使用PHP来控制CSS样式,从而控制图片的显示与隐藏。具体做法是在HTML中添加一个class属性,并根据PHP的条件来设置该属性的值。然后使用CSS来控制图片的显示与隐藏。示例代码如下:

    “`php





    图片>


    “`

    在上面的示例代码中,首先设置了一个变量`$showImage`,并赋值为`true`。然后在HTML中的``标签中根据条件`$showImage`来设置`class`属性的值。如果`$showImage`的值为`false`,则`class`属性的值为`image-hidden`,即图片将被隐藏。

    综上所述,可以通过PHP的if语句和CSS来控制内容是否显示图片。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中,可以使用条件语句来控制在网页中是否显示图片,而在CSS中,则可以使用display属性来控制图片的可见性。以下是关于如何使用PHP和CSS来控制内容是否显示图片的几种方法:

    1. 使用PHP的条件语句控制图片显示:
    在PHP中,可以使用if语句或者三元运算符来检测某个条件是否成立,并根据条件的结果来决定是否显示图片。
    “`php
    ‘;
    }
    ?>
    “`
    上述代码会根据变量$showImage的值来决定是否显示图片。如果$showImage为true,则会在网页中显示图片;如果$showImage为false,则不会显示图片。

    2. 使用CSS的display属性控制图片可见性:
    在CSS中,可以使用display属性来控制元素的可见性,包括图片。可以将display属性设置为none以隐藏图片,或者设置为block或inline以显示图片。
    “`html

    My Image
    “`
    通过给图片元素添加class为hide-image,在CSS中设置display为none,可以隐藏图片。如果要显示图片,只需将class属性修改为其他值即可。

    3. 使用PHP和CSS结合控制图片显示:
    可以结合使用PHP和CSS来控制图片的显示方式。通过在PHP中设置一个变量,然后将该变量传递给HTML的类或ID,再在CSS中通过该类或ID来控制图片的可见性。
    “`php

    My Image

    “`
    上述代码中,根据$showImage的值,在CSS中动态设置是否使用background-image属性。如果$showImage为true,则设置背景图片;否则不设置。通过给一个元素添加该属性,来显示或隐藏背景图片。

    以上是几种使用PHP和CSS来控制内容是否显示图片的方法。可以根据具体需求选择适合的方法来实现图片的显示与隐藏。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PHP和CSS中都可以控制内容是否显示图片。下面分别通过PHP和CSS来讲解控制图片显示的方法和操作流程。

    ## 通过PHP控制图片显示

    1. 首先,需要提供一个文件路径或者图片的URL地址。可以通过一个数据库或者一个数组来存储和管理图片的路径。

    2. 在HTML中使用PHP来控制图片的显示。可以使用条件语句来判断是否显示图片。例如,使用`if`语句判断是否有图片路径,如果有则显示图片,否则不显示。

    “`php







    Image

    “`

    2. 在CSS样式表中,使用`display`属性来控制图片的显示。可以根据需要将`display`属性设置为`none`或`block`。

    “`css
    .image-container img {
    display: block; /* 显示图片 */
    /* display: none; */ /* 不显示图片 */
    }
    “`

    3. 上述代码中,如果`display`属性设置为`block`,那么图片将被显示。如果设置为`none`,那么图片将不被显示。

    注意:上述方法可以通过使用动态的CSS类来动态控制图片的显示。在PHP中,可以根据条件来动态添加或移除CSS类。在CSS样式表中,根据类选择器来设置图片的显示属性。

    综上所述,通过PHP和CSS都可以控制图片的显示。在PHP中,可以使用条件语句来判断是否显示图片;在CSS中,可以使用`display`属性来控制图片的显示与否。根据具体需求选择合适的方法。

  • 2年前 0条评论
    注册PingCode 在线客服
    站长微信
    站长微信
    电话联系

    400-800-1024

    工作日9:30-21:00在线

    分享本页
    返回顶部